The Ancient Beginnings

The Oriental Shorthair Cat, with its captivating appearance and sharp intellect, has a history that dates back centuries. This elegant breed shares its lineage with the revered Siamese cats, known for their distinctive looks and personalities.

Siamese Roots

To understand the Oriental Shorthair’s history, we must first acknowledge the Siamese cats. These cats, originating from Thailand (formerly Siam), gained fame for their striking blue almond-shaped eyes, short coats, and vocal nature. Siamese cats were treasured by royalty and were even considered sacred in ancient Siamese culture.

The Evolution of Diversity

The Oriental Shorthair’s journey began when breeders sought to expand the Siamese cat’s genetic diversity. They introduced a wide range of coat colors and patterns, which set the Oriental Shorthair apart from its Siamese ancestors.

The Oriental Shorthair Emerges

The deliberate breeding of Siamese cats with diverse coat colors led to the emergence of the Oriental Shorthair. These cats retained the elegance and grace of the Siamese while sporting a rainbow of coat options, from solid shades to enchanting patterns.

Caring for Your Oriental Shorthair Cat: Tips for a Happy and Healthy Companion 🐱

Grooming Made Simple

Oriental shorthairs have short coats, which means grooming is a breeze. A weekly brushing will help reduce shedding and keep their coat in top-notch condition. Plus, it’s an excellent bonding opportunity between you and your feline friend.

Nutritious Diet

Maintaining a well-balanced diet is crucial for your Oriental Shorthair’s health. High-quality cat food that meets their dietary needs is essential. Consult your veterinarian to determine the right portion sizes and feeding schedule.

Hydration Station

Always provide fresh, clean water for your cat. Hydration is key to their well-being. Consider investing in a cat water fountain if your feline friend prefers running water. it’s a fancy touch they’ll appreciate!

Exercise and Playtime

Oriental shorthairs are playful and active. Engage them with interactive toys, feather wands, or laser pointers to keep them mentally and physically stimulated. Playtime is not just fun; it’s essential for their overall happiness.

Regular Vet Check-Ups

Routine visits to the veterinarian are vital for your Oriental Shorthair’s health. These cats can be prone to dental issues and certain genetic conditions, so early detection is crucial. Keep up with vaccinations and preventive care.

Litter Box Etiquette

Maintain a clean litter box. Oriental Shorthairs are known for their cleanliness, and they’ll appreciate a tidy restroom. Scoop the box daily and change the litter regularly to keep it fresh.

Safe Indoor Environment

These cats are well-suited for indoor living. Ensure your home is a safe haven by removing potential hazards and providing plenty of stimulating activities. Cat trees and cozy hideaways are great additions.

Mental Stimulation

Challenge their intelligent minds with puzzle toys and interactive games. Oriental Shorthairs thrive on mental stimulation, and it’s an excellent way to prevent boredom.

Affection and Interaction

These cats adore human companionship. Spend quality time with your Oriental Shorthair, cuddle, and have conversations with them. They’ll appreciate the attention and bond with you even more.

Feeding Your Oriental Shorthair Cat: A Recipe for Health and Happiness 🍽️

Quality is Key

When it comes to feeding your Oriental Shorthair, quality should be your top priority. Opt for high-quality cat food that meets their dietary needs. Look for options that list a protein source, like chicken or fish, as the primary ingredient.

Kibble vs. Wet Food

You have options when it comes to the form of cat food: dry kibble or wet food. Many owners choose a combination of both. Wet food can help keep your cat hydrated, while dry kibble can assist with dental health. Consult your veterinarian to determine the best mix.

Portion Control

Maintaining the right portion sizes is essential to prevent overfeeding or underfeeding. Follow the feeding guidelines on the cat food packaging as a starting point, but remember that each cat is unique. Adjust the portions based on your cat’s age, activity level, and health.

Fresh Water Supply

Always provide fresh, clean water for your Oriental Shorthair. Proper hydration is crucial for their well-being. Consider investing in a cat water fountain if your cat prefers running water; it can encourage them to drink more.

Avoid Overindulgence

These cats have a healthy appetite, but it’s essential to resist overindulging them with treats. Treats should be given in moderation and not replace regular meals. Stick to healthy cat treats or use kibble as an occasional reward.

Special Dietary Considerations

If your Oriental Shorthair has specific dietary requirements due to allergies or health issues, consult with your veterinarian to find the right food options. Specialized diets can help manage certain conditions.

Regular Feeding Schedule

Establish a regular feeding schedule for your cat. Cats thrive on routine, and having set mealtimes can help maintain their digestive health and prevent obesity. Stick to a consistent schedule.

Watch for Allergies

Some cats may have food allergies or sensitivities. If you notice signs of allergies, such as skin problems or digestive issues, consult with your veterinarian. They can recommend hypoallergenic food options.

FAQs: Your Curiosities Satisfied

Let’s answer some common questions about Oriental shorthair cats:

1: Are Oriental shorthair cats hypoallergenic?

No, they’re not hypoallergenic, but their short coats may produce fewer allergens compared to long-haired breeds.

2: Do they get along with other pets?

Oriental shorthairs are generally sociable and can coexist with other cats and even dogs when introduced properly.

3: How often should I groom them?

Their short coat requires minimal grooming. A weekly brush helps reduce shedding and maintain their coat’s health.

4: What’s their lifespan?

With proper care, Oriental Shorthairs can live up to 15–20 years, providing years of feline companionship.

5: Are they prone to health issues?

They can be susceptible to dental problems and certain genetic conditions, so regular vet check-ups are essential.

6: Can they be trained?

Yes, these intelligent cats are trainable and can learn tricks and commands.

7: What’s their energy level?

Oriental Shorthairs are energetic and enjoy play, but they also appreciate lounging and relaxing.

8: Do they make good family pets?

Absolutely! They can be wonderful family pets, especially in households that provide mental and physical stimulation.

9: What distinguishes them from Siamese cats?

While they share ancestry, Oriental shorthairs have a wider range of coat colors and patterns than Siamese cats.

10: Are they known for being vocal?

Yes, they often express themselves with melodious voices, making them great conversation partners.
